JavaScript Classes 2025: Why Constructor Functions Are the Key! 🔥 | ES6 OOP Demystified

Опубликовано: 25 Март 2025
на канале: Glams Era
2
0

💥 Classes Are Just Syntactic Sugar? Master How Constructors Power Modern JavaScript OOP in 2025! 💥

In this Udemy JavaScript Grandmaster 2025 video, you’ll discover why constructor functions are the hidden engine behind ES6 classes – and how understanding them unlocks true OOP mastery for React, Node.js, and beyond!

✅ What You’ll Learn:

The Link Between Classes & Constructors: class User vs function User() {} under the hood.

Prototype Chain Secrets: How extends and super map to old-school prototypes.

Real-World Demo: Rebuild a class Product using raw constructor functions!

Pro Tip: Debug class-based code by thinking in prototypes.

📌 Timestamps:
0:00 – Why Classes ≠ Magic (Demo: Class vs Constructor Side-by-Side!)
1:30 – ES5 Constructors: The Foundation of ES6 Classes
4:15 – class Syntax Demystified: What Happens When You Hit “Run”?
7:00 – extends = Prototype Chains in Disguise
10:20 – super() vs ParentConstructor.call(this)
13:30 – Why This Matters for 2025 Frameworks (React, Angular, Vue)

💡 Perfect For:

Developers confused by the class keyword’s “magic”.

Coders transitioning from ES5 to modern JavaScript.

Udemy Grandmaster 2025 students prepping for senior engineering roles!

🔗 Master JavaScript’s Core:
👉 Full Playlist: Udemy JavaScript Grandmaster 2025

💬 Comment Below: “Do YOU prefer classes or raw constructors?” Let’s debate! ⚡


Смотрите видео JavaScript Classes 2025: Why Constructor Functions Are the Key! 🔥 | ES6 OOP Demystified онлайн без регистрации, длительностью часов минут секунд в хорошем качестве. Это видео добавил пользователь Glams Era 25 Март 2025, не забудьте поделиться им ссылкой с друзьями и знакомыми, на нашем сайте его посмотрели 2 раз и оно понравилось 0 людям.